From the authors who helped you pass Step 1, this is your high-yield review for the USMLE Step 2 CK. Completely revised to cover all core areas on the boards, including information on newly tested patient safety and quality improvement topics, First Aid for the USMLE Step 2 CK: Ninth Edition features:
High-yield, bulleted presentation of diseases and disorders you need to remember
Integrated flash-facts in margins test your knowledge at the point of learning
Embedded case vignettes test your application of knowledge
Key facts and mnemonics reinforce essential information
Rapid-review section for last-minute cramming
Includes hundreds of color clinical images and illustrations

About the Author: Tao Le, MD (Louisville, KY) and Vikas Bhushan, MD
Tao Le, MD, MHS (Louisville, KY) is Assistant Professor of Medicine and Pediatrics in the Division of Allergy and Clinical Immunology at The University of Louisville. He is also affiliated with the Division of Allergy and Immunology at The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ine (Baltimore, MD). He is the founder of USMLE-Rx.com, an online subscription database of USMLE review questions. Vikas Bhushan, MD (Los Angeles, CA) is a practicing diagnostic radiologist.
